> Where can i find the reference documentation of "Tkinter" 

Tkinter is a module, not part of the language, so it is documented
in the modules section. But the documentation is not 100% complete
and for details you often need to look at the Tk/Tcl documentation
too.

Also there are several Tkinter web sites that offer additional
information. One of the official web pages has links to them.
This is probably the most comprehensive:

https://infohost.nmt.edu/tcc/help/pubs/tkinter/web/index.html

And there is a PDF link on their web page.
